Veteran John Buckman Appointed to Borough Council
The Vacancy Board appointed long time resident John Buckman to fill the Ward 2 vacancy created by the resignation of Lori Clipner. Ms. Clipner resigned her seat on January 28th when she moved out of the Borough.
Mr. Buckman is a 27-year Borough Resident and a military veteran. He also served for many years as a volunteer Fire Fighter. He is a small business owner who operates a local woodworking and furniture company. Borough Council and Staff welcome Mr. Buckman and look forward to working with him continuing the Doylestown success story.
